Benefits of Tridion Access Management The Tridion Docs 15 release adds support for Tridion Access Management, or simply Access Management. The application provides a single, simplified interface for managing access to Tridion applications by end users and by the APIs for other applications.
Managing Tridion Docs users in Access Management The Users tab in Access Management shows users of Tridion Docs applications (those configured for Access Management) who have logged in and been provisioned in the system. From Access Management, administrators can modify user profiles, including a user's access settings for individual applications.
Managing service accounts in Access Management Service accounts enable applications and other non-human users to authenticate through Access Management and be authorized to access APIs.
